Not every treatment is a spray

General Pest Control in Ras Al Khaimah or Gel, Baits and Traps?

Many customers search for general spraying, but spraying is not the only answer and it is not always the best one. Kitchens and appliance zones may benefit more from bait or gel placement, rodents require access review and traps, and flying insects may need breeding-source treatment rather than air spraying.

A better pest control service uses only the treatment that is needed and places it where it is useful. Heavy random application does not automatically mean a better result. Food-preparation zones, pet areas, toys, beds and sensitive items should be reviewed and handled properly before treatment starts.

Some bait systems need time for the pest to feed and carry the effect back to the activity point. These products should not be cleaned away immediately. Other areas may need cleaning after a defined period. The instructions for each method are different and must be followed exactly.

How Is the Method Chosen?

  • Gel and bait: Suitable for some hidden pests near kitchens and appliances.
  • Spot treatment: Targets cracks, edges and defined movement lines.
  • Perimeter treatment: Used around external entry points when appropriate.
  • Traps: Useful for monitoring or controlling certain rodents and pests.
  • Gap sealing: Helps reduce rodent or reptile entry when supported by site inspection.

The Better Result Starts by Knowing Why the Pest Appeared

A pesticide alone does not fix a water leak, close an access gap or remove exposed food. Combining treatment with source control reduces the chance of recurring activity.

Why pests return

Why Pests Return After Treatment and How to Reduce Recurrence

Pests may return after pest control in Ras Al Khaimah because eggs remain, an activity point was missed, access continues through drains or gaps, or the problem is being reintroduced from a neighbouring unit or stored items. Some sightings after treatment do not automatically mean the service has failed, but continuing or increasing activity should be reviewed.

Common causes of repeat activity include water leaks under sinks, rubbish left overnight, exposed pet food, cardboard storage, gaps around pipes, damaged window mesh, standing water, infested second-hand furniture or cleaning away the bait or gel immediately after it is placed. The practical cause must be addressed instead of simply repeating the same treatment every time.

It helps to record where and when the pest appears after the service. This shows whether the activity is decreasing or shifting. If a follow-up visit is included, send updated photos before the next appointment so the team can adjust the treatment rather than repeat the same step without changes.

  • Fix leaks and keep wet areas dry.
  • Store food and grains in sealed containers.
  • Remove rubbish and food debris before night.
  • Seal gaps around pipes, doors and windows.
  • Do not remove bait or gel before the advised time.
Safety guidance

Preparation Before Pest Treatment in Ras Al Khaimah and Re-Entry After Service

Preparation requirements depend on the type of pest control in Ras Al Khaimah and the method being used. Some treatments require the area to be vacated for a period, while certain baits or gel applications involve different instructions. The required preparation is explained before the appointment.

Before the visit, cover food and eating utensils, move toys and pet items away, and protect aquariums in line with safe handling instructions. Tell the team if there is pregnancy, allergy sensitivity, a respiratory issue or pets on site so the method and safety instructions can be reviewed carefully.

After treatment, do not enter before the advised time, do not touch bait or wash gel points away, and do not apply household products over the treated area unless instructed. Ventilate when told to do so, and clean food-preparation surfaces exactly as advised. If anything is unclear, ask before the team leaves.

Quick preparation checklist:
  • Send a clear pest photo before the appointment.
  • Cover food, utensils and sensitive personal items.
  • Keep children and pets away from the treatment area.
  • Tell the team about aquariums, allergies and restrictions.
  • Follow the stated re-entry, cleaning and ventilation instructions.
  • Do not mix household chemicals with the applied treatment.
